What You’ll Do (Your Mission)
As the
Account Manager
for the Kershaw County School District, you will be the primary
Facilities Leader
for a cluster of schools totaling nearly 500,000 cleanable square feet. You will lead, coach, and inspire a team of approximately 40 employees. Your day‑to‑day will involve managing labor budgets in Google Sheets, conducting site audits, and maintaining "honey‑over‑vinegar" relationships with school administrators. As the
Operations Supervisor , you will ensure that our service delivery is consistent, cost‑effective, and safe, especially during our high‑intensity summer cleanup programs.
What You Bring To The Team
Leadership Excellence : 2–5 years of experience in coaching, motivating, and leading diverse teams.
Operational Brain : Ability to forecast productivity, manage payroll (Dayforce), and handle procurement (Coupa).
Dedication : A commitment to client satisfaction and a "whatever it takes" attitude for your team and buildings.
Technical Skills : Comfortable navigating Google Suites and learning new software quickly.
